A Canadian dance studio is causing a stir with its latest class: pole dancing for kids.
The twisted grip dance and fitness studio in British Columbia offers various pole dancing classes for adults but now, young girls can enroll in little spinners, to learn how to do acrobatics on a pole!
The instructor says it was her adult clients who came up with the idea for children's classes and she says they're about fitness and fun, not sex.
"There is nothing provocative. There is nothing sexual about it. It's pure fitness and strength and fun. I mean kids love climbing trees. They will climb anything," dance instructor Kristy Craig said.
So far there are four children, including one boy, enrolled in the class.
It costs $70 to participate.
